AMF panel and generator packages are designed to provide
emergency power during a mains supply failure.
During operation, the control panel of the AMF monitors the
mains entering the building. If a mains failure occurs, the
panel will disconnect the mains from the load, the
generator is started and its output connected to the load.
(The load being appliances, lights, etc in use within the
house/office/factory at the time of mains failure).
The generator continues to supply the building until the
mains supply returns.
The generator then automatically disconnects, stops and the
mains is re-connected to the load.
The AMF panel reverts to the standby mode ready to respond
in the event of another mains failure.

AMF means auto mains failure panel, actuvally it is a watch
dog, it always monitor the AC input source, if there is any
failure or any abnormality in the input supply, immediately
it will disconnect the load from main source and change the
load path on generator and also it will send start signal
to gen set. when after resumtions of main AC supply it will
check the healthy ness of the supply if it is healthy then
with little time delay it will change over the load on main
source and also sends stop signal to the genset.
